Intravascular Flow Patterns in Transforaminal Epidural Injections: A Comparative Study of the Cervical and Lumbar Vertebral Segments
Anesthesia & Analgesia, 06/26/09
Kim DW et al. - The incidence of vascular injection in CTEIs is significantly higher than in LTEIs, suggesting that CTEIs should be performed more cautiously. Furthermore, the vascular injection rate of CTEIs is much higher than that previously reported. This finding suggests the need for a proper volume of contrast injection (3 mL) to detect vascular flow, especially in simultaneous perineural and vascular injections.
